The story of my great-grandfather — German by origin, whose life was cut short by Stalinist repression. One photograph as an attempt to preserve the presence of a man they tried to erase.

“Certificate of Rehabilitation. A Document That Restores a Name”

An official certificate issued by the military prosecutor confirming the rehabilitation of my great-grandfather, Alexander Ivanovich Gass, executed in 1938. A document that records not only a crime, but a delayed return of justice.

Letter on the Issuance of a Death Certificate and the Return of a Rehabilitation Record

An official letter from the Security Service of Ukraine in the Kharkiv region to the daughter of Alexander Ivanovych Gass, informing her about the issuance of a death certificate and the return of his rehabilitation record. Received in 1994, during the period when the archives of repressed families were first opened in independent Ukraine.

Cause of Death: Execution by Shooting

The death certificate of Oleksandr Ivanovych Gass, issued in 1994 after the opening of Soviet repression archives. A document that legally records the execution of 29 September 1938.
